Welcome to Norfolk Historic Townhouse, a beautifully restored grade II listed Georgian property in the heart of King’s Lynn’s historic quarter. This elegant four-bedroom holiday let is just steps from the River Ouse and 30 minutes from Hunstanton’s seafront. Filled with light from large sash windows and featuring lovely period details, Norfolk Historic Townhouse is a truly special stay.
The space
Unwind in the cosy living room with two sofas, a wall-mounted TV, and a log burner for chilly evenings.

The fully equipped kitchen includes a fridge, freezer, oven, hob, dishwasher, washing machine, and a cafetiere for fresh coffee. The extendable dining table comfortably seats the full occupancy.

The property boasts a king bedroom, a double room, a twin room, and a study which has a sofa bed (please let us know at the time of booking if the sofa bed will be required for your stay).

The first floor has a large family bathroom with a shower over the bath, plus a convenient ground-floor W/C.

Enjoy the private enclosed courtyard with a table and chairs, perfect for relaxing or al fresco dining.
Guest access
Guests have access to the full property.

The keys to Norfolk Historic Townhouse are accessed via a key safe box, and full details will be provided prior to check-in.
